How they compare

Syria currently reports 115,642 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re against 102,908 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in Egypt, a difference of 12,734 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Syria's figure about 1.1 times Egypt's.

Across all 34 years both countries report, Syria has been ahead every year.

Egypt ranks 130th and Syria ranks 127th of 198 countries.

Syria has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Egypt Syria Difference Ahead
1970s 6,931 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 16,905 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 9,974 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re Syria
1980s 12,285 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 23,032 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 10,746 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re Syria
1990s 18,964 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 31,672 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 12,709 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re Syria
2000s 37,586 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 65,430 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 27,844 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re Syria
2010s 66,611 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 115,642 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re 49,031 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re Syria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
